Summary

Trane Technologies plc engages in the designing, manufacturing, selling, and servicing of solutions for heating, ventilation, air conditioning, and transport refrigeration.

What does this company do? What do they sell? Who are their customers?
Trane Technologies plc is a global leader specializing in the design, manufacture, sales, and service of advanced solutions in heating, ventilation, air conditioning (HVAC), and transport refrigeration. The company serves commercial, industrial, and residential customers through its prominent brands, Trane and Thermo King. Trane’s client base includes property developers, building owners, facility managers, data centers, and logistics providers that require temperature control and environmental solutions. A core part of their business model is the provision of energy-efficient systems and services, with a focus on sustainability and regulatory compliance. Their strong U.S. presence is complemented by a growing international footprint, with continued expansion into emerging markets and high-growth segments like healthcare and data centers.

What were the major events that happened this quarter?
In the most recent quarter, Trane Technologies reported notable sales growth of 5.5% year-over-year, but revenue slightly missed consensus estimates. The company launched a new thermal management system targeting AI-driven data centers, specifically in partnership with NVIDIA’s Omniverse DSX Blueprint. Operating margins improved, highlighting successful cost controls and efficiency gains. The company's order backlog reached a substantial $7.3 billion, signaling strong future demand. The quarter also saw the company maintain its guidance amid macroeconomic uncertainty and experience significant stock price volatility related to industry trends and competitive product launches.

What does this company do? What do they sell? Who are their customers?
Trane Technologies plc is a prominent player in the climate solutions industry, renowned for its commitment to sustainable innovation. The company specializes in designing, manufacturing, and servicing solutions for heating, ventilation, air conditioning, and transport refrigeration. It also offers an extensive array of building management and control systems, ensuring energy efficiency and smart operations. Trane Technologies caters to a diverse customer base, which includes commercial and residential buildings, transportation sectors, and industrial applications. Operating under the Trane and Thermo King brands, the company has established a marked presence across the globe, leveraging sales offices, distributors, and dealers to market its products and services effectively. With a focus on sustainability, Trane Technologies is actively engaged in reducing the environmental impact of its solutions, thereby aligning with the growing global demand for eco-friendly practices and products.
What are the company’s main products or services?
Trane Technologies offers an extensive range of climate control solutions, including HVAC systems, designed to cater to both residential and commercial buildings. Its product lineup features advanced heating and cooling systems, such as geothermal and ductless units, that are engineered for energy efficiency and sustainability.,The Thermo King brand under Trane Technologies provides innovative transport refrigeration solutions, ensuring the safe and efficient temperature management of goods in transit. These products are vital for industries that rely on the cold chain for operations, including food and pharmaceuticals.,In addition to traditional climate control systems, Trane Technologies offers building management systems which integrate control and automation to optimize energy use, enhance comfort, and reduce operational expenses for building owners.,The company also addresses temporary climate control needs with its portable and rental HVAC systems, providing businesses with flexible short-term solutions for heating and cooling.,Trane Technologies extends its service portfolio with comprehensive maintenance and repair services, ensuring long-term reliability and efficient performance of customers' HVAC and transport refrigeration systems.
